So what did I learn this year? Honestly, the thing I was touched by most was when the speaker encouraged us to thrive in challenging situations rather than just cope, or survive. I thought about my own life in relation. What have I done in the past 6 years since my greatest challenge became a part of my life? Of course I am referring to the arrival of Sarah. Having a special needs child has without a doubt been the most difficult thing in my life thus far. There is no way to fully share the enormity of the impact that has on one's life and so I won't try. Those who are close to me see a glimpse of it and know its a challenge but in all honestly seeing what we deal with doesn't come close to actually living it hour by hour, day by day, week by week......
But honestly, what have I done in the midst of this challenge? I am surviving. I am coping. And I am doing those things well. But am I thriving? Am I growing? Certainly I do not think growth has been absent from my life since Sarah's arrival but I don't think I've really embraced my daughter as a gift FOR my growth. Instead I've kind of looked her as a challenge God's placed in my life that I would grow from. I think it is different, although it sounds very much the same. So I guess the point of it is I am changing my attitude and eager to see how I can thrive in the midst of the challenges God's placed in my life. Survival just isn't enough.....
